Russian President Vladimir Putin officially launched a key plant at one of the world’s largest copper deposits after the facility was rebuilt almost from scratch following a fire almost three years ago.

The hydrometallurgical plant at the Udokan deposit will produce refined copper with a purity of 99.99% in cathode form and is planned to bring total capacity of the site to 150,000 tons of copper per year.

The company is working on the second stage of the project, which could boost capacity to 550,000 tons, it said earlier.

Prices on the London Metal Exchange are near record highs after the market was hit by a brief but intense squeeze last month, as traders competed for access to near term metal.

Ukraine faces salary delays for the Armed Forces starting in October

Head of the Verkhovna Rada’s financial committee Danil Getmantsev warned that Ukraine risks losing €4.2 billion from the EU and $1.6 billion from the IMF.

He cited the failure to vote on canceling tax exemptions for parcels under €150 as the cause. "If deputies do not come to their senses immediately, everyone will feel the consequences in the form of delayed payments to military personnel," Getmantsev stated. He noted that funding issues may manifest as early as October.

Warsaw classifies the fire at WB Electronics, a drone component manufacturer, as a "malicious act of sabotage." Tusk stated there is "no doubt it was deliberate arson," with investigators probing possible foreign intelligence involvement. WB Electronics produces parts for FlyEye and Warmate drones used by Poland and Ukraine. Damage is estimated at over $4 million, though likely understated.

Vladimir Putin commissioned new Rosseti facilities in the Far East, including the 500 kV "Varyag" substation and a 500 km power line connecting it to the Primorskaya GRES. This is Russia's largest grid project in recent years, involving over 2,500 workers.

The infrastructure will provide additional capacity to the region's south, including Vladivostok and special economic zones, supporting the development of the entire Far East.

Vladimir Putin launched new stages of five projects in the Far East with support from VEB.

International shuttle trains with China were started at the Artyom logistics center to strengthen transport links.

Commissioning works began at the Nakhodka mineral fertilizer plant, which will process natural gas into methanol.

Construction of the Second Severomuysky Tunnel has started at the Eastern Polygon, increasing capacity on the BAM and Trans-Siberian railways.

At the Udokan mining complex, a hydrometallurgical plant was launched, producing high-purity cathode copper (99.999%).
